Why architecture matters here

A2A message architecture matters because cross-vendor interoperability requires strict structure. Missing fields break integrations; unversioned methods surprise consumers; unsigned messages allow impersonation.

Cost is small — structured metadata is bytes.

Reliability comes from idempotency + signatures + audit. Retries safe; disputes resolvable.

The architecture: every field explained

Walk the diagram top to bottom.

Sender agent. Produces a request message on behalf of user.

JSON-RPC 2.0 envelope. id + jsonrpc + method + params. Standard.

Recipient agent. Consumes; validates; responds with id + result or error.

Method versioning. methods include version (e.g., translate.v2). Capability check first.

Trace context. W3C traceparent propagated in message headers or params.

Signature. Sender signs message; recipient verifies against agent card's public key.

Idempotency key. Client-supplied unique key; server dedupes retries.

Cost + budget. Request includes budget hint; response includes cost consumed.

Error format. code (retryable/non-retryable), message, data. Clients route by class.

Audit trail. Both parties log message ID + hash + parties + outcome.

End-to-end message flow

Trace a message. Sender agent creates request: ``` { "jsonrpc": "2.0", "id": "req-abc123", "method": "translate.v2", "params": { "text": "Hello", "target_lang": "de" }, "meta": { "trace_id": "0af7651916cd43dd8448eb211c80319c", "signature": "0x…", "idempotency_key": "user-42-session-xyz-1", "budget_usd": 0.10 } } ``` Recipient verifies signature against sender's agent card public key. Extracts trace context; attaches to spans. Checks idempotency key: if already processed, return prior result.

Runs translation. Consumes $0.02.

Returns: ``` { "jsonrpc": "2.0", "id": "req-abc123", "result": { "translated": "Hallo", "cost_usd": 0.02 } } ``` Both parties log. Audit consistent.

Error scenario: translation service down. Returns error with code: ``` { "jsonrpc": "2.0", "id": "req-abc123", "error": { "code": "SERVICE_UNAVAILABLE", "retryable": true, "message": "translation service temporarily down" } } ``` Sender knows to retry with backoff.
